Grammy Linda's Tuna Melt
- 4 potato buns (like Martin's Potato Sandwich Rolls) or 4 hamburger buns or 4 English muffins
- 2 (6 ounce) cans solid white tuna packed in water
- 34 cup mayonnaise
- 1 stalk celery, chopped (11 inches long )
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- salt & pepper, to taste
- 2 tomatoes, sliced horizontally
- 8 slices American cheese
- Split rolls in half horizontally; and brown under broiler or on skillet.
- Place rolls cut side up on a cookie sheet pan and set aside.
- Mix the 5 tuna salad ingredients.
- Refrigerate until ready to make the sandwiches.
- Horizontally slice tomatoes of choice.
- Divide tuna salad into 8 portionsl and place each portion atop a browned roll half.
- Top each with i-2 slices tomato.
- Top each with a slice of cheese.
- Turn on your oven broiler and place pan of sandwiches 4 inches below broiling element.
- Watch carefully and remove when cheese melts to your satisfaction.
- ( I do not care for charred or brown cheese; so I remove as soon as cheese drapes over the tomatoes.)
- Serve immediately.
- Yum!
- Tip: For a large group, the sandwiches may be compiled several hours before needed and broiled right before serving.
